Find balance in your life from "summary" of Be Calm by Jill Weber
Finding balance in your life is crucial for your overall well-being. In today's fast-paced world, it's easy to get caught up in the hustle and bustle of everyday life. We often find ourselves juggling multiple responsibilities, whether it's work, family, social obligations, or personal interests. While it's important to be productive and achieve our goals, it's equally important to take a step back and assess how we're managing our time and energy.
When we're out of balance, we may feel overwhelmed, stressed, or burnt out. This can have negative effects on our physical, mental, and emotional health. Finding balance means making time for the things that matter most to you, whether it's spending time with loved ones, pursuing a hobby, or simply taking a moment to relax and recharge.
One way to find balance is by setting boundaries and prioritizing your time. This means knowing when to say no to things that don't align with your values or goals, and being intentional about how you spend your time. It's also important to take care of yourself physically by getting enough sleep, eating well, and exercising regularly. When you prioritize self-care, you'll have more energy and resilience to handle life's challenges.
Another key aspect of finding balance is managing your stress levels. Stress is a natural part of life, but too much of it can have harmful effects on your health. Finding healthy ways to cope with stress, such as meditation, exercise, or spending time in nature, can help you feel more grounded and centered. By learning to manage your stress effectively, you'll be better equipped to handle whatever comes your way.Finding balance in your life is about creating a sense of harmony and fulfillment. It's about being mindful of how you're spending your time and energy, and making intentional choices that support your well-being. When you find balance, you'll feel more at peace, more resilient, and better equipped to navigate life's ups and downs. So take a moment to reflect on what balance means to you, and consider how you can create more of it in your daily life.
